About the Provider

Description:

Our family child care offers a warm, loving and quality home-like setting -- a natural environment for children during early childhood -- while providing consistent care for infants, toddlers, preschool and school age children.

 

We provide a safe, inviting space and nurturing care complete with educational activities designed to meet the needs and interests of all children while promoting individual development. 

 

Your children's development, happiness, and health is our number one priority. In addition to a safe and helpful environment, we take daily trips to local parks and serve nutritional meals to establish a healthy lifestyle for each child. 

 

Rides to and from school, if needed, are included as well for both the morning and afternoon. 

 

As a mother of two myself (now 17 and 18 respectively), and running a child care for over 14 years, I understand the needs and concerns that many parents have and try to make you and your child as comfortable in our care as possible. Daily updates are given through messages/pictures sent to your phone (if wanted), as well as at pick up. 

 

We also accept Naccrra, Military Fee assistance Programs, and we offer a sibling discount.

Summary 03/09/2020, 10/29/2019, 06/28/2018, 08/08/2017 Type B Citation: 3;

*Type B citation is for a violation that, if not corrected, may become an immediate risk to the health, safety or personal rights of clients. Examples include faulty medical record keeping and lack of adequate staff training.
